From: Yu Kuai <yukuai3@xxxxxxxxxx> min_shallow_depth must be less or equal to any shallow_depth value, and it's 1 currently, and this will change default wake_batch to 1, causing performance degradation for fast disk with high concurrency. This patch make following changes: - set default minimal async_depth to 64, to avoid performance degradation in the commen case. And user can set lower value if necessary. - disable throttling asynchronous requests by default, to prevent performance degradation in some special setup. User must set a value to async_depth to enable it. - if async_depth is set already, don't reset it if user sets new nr_requests.
